Care guide

Overview

Oriental Fire-bellied Toad (Bombina orientalis) โ€” a hardy, active, diurnal semi-aquatic frog and a great beginner amphibian, kept in a half-land/half-water setup. Mildly toxic skin secretions mean no handling and hand-washing after contact.

Care

Water & behavior

Water

Large shallow dechlorinated water area with easy exits; change water frequently.
